The U.S. Department of Agriculture says a Hattiesburg, Miss.-based company is recalling sausages for possible listeria contamination.
Enslin & Son Packing Co. says a batch of Cedar Grove Red Hots in 1.5 pound and 2 pound packages tested possible for listeria.
The packages, bearing the number P-31806, were shipped to stores in the Mississippi cities of Meridian and Philadelphia. They contain a use or freeze by date of Sept. 24 or Sept. 28.
No reports of illnesses have been received. Listeria bacteria can cause serious illness and death.
